Super Strong heavy built custom expedition trawler. US built by Patti Shipyards to the highest standards with pre-blasted and zinced steel. Built 1983, major conversion and refit 2005-2015. Very little rust. 10000 gal fuel, 8000 gal FW. Sleeps 12 guest and 6 crew. Fully equipped and comfortable layout. Can be operated as 12 passenger un-inspected charter vessel, or easily converted to private or fishing vessel. Seaworthy and sea-kindly. Reliable and efficient.

Main cabins located aft of mid ship and below main deck. Large hallway to 5 cabins with upper and lower single bunks. One cabin with lower double. Easily converted to have a masters cabin. Crew cabin for 4 in forward compartment below main deck. Double bunks in wheelhouse and behind wheelhouse. 3 Air conditioners for separate interior spaces. Three large heads and showers on main deck. Salon with bench and chair seating for 14. Drink bar with ice maker, drink refrigerator, ice maker and sink. TV, DVD, surround sound.
1998 twin 855NTA 400 hp Cummins, rebuilt in 2011. 5:1 Tonaco transmissions to 4 inch shafts both replaced in 2009. 54” four blade SS wheels in kort nozzles, balanced and new bearings in2022. 2006 40kw Northern lights generator, 2011 40kw Northern lights generator. All keel cooled and dry exhaust. 1hp 24 inch ventilator fan, new in 2025. 250 gal sewage tank with 2hp pump, new in 2018 with spare. 3hp bilge pump, new in 2024. 1.5 hp salt water washdown pump with spare. 1.5 hp fresh water pump with spare, 30 gallon hydro pneumatic tank, new in 2019. 40 gallon hot water heater, new in 2010. Main and secondary fresh water filters. Three banks of 12V batteries with three chargers, two banks of 24V batteries with two chargers. Hydraulic power steering with helm valve and electric solenoid valve. 7hp electric hydraulic pump. Electronic antifouling. Two electric 15cfm Bauer SCUBA compressors.
GE electric stove and oven combo, microwave convection combo. 13 cu ft freezer, 22 cu ft commercial double door refrigerator. Double galley sink with over and under cabinets, drawers, pantry, serving counter, full set of dishes and cooking utensils. Drink bar with drawers and cabinets, ice maker, drink refrigerator, bar sink and coffee maker.
500 lbs fisherman anchor to 200ft 1/2in chain with double 5 hp windlass. 3000 plus feet of sections of 1 inch to 1 3/8 inch nylon line. Ten 500 watt deck flood lights. 12 plus SCUBA tanks and weights. Fishing equipment. 11 ft Avon dinghies with Yamaha 15hp. 1000lbs electric 15 cu ft chest freezers.
Furuno 64 mile radar, Furuno 36 mile radar, Furuno Fish Finder, Furuno GPS, Magnavox GPS, 6” Danforth compass, twin Icom VHF radios both to high gain commercial antennas, Icom SSB radio, Loudhailer, ACR AIS transceiver, Dell laptop ships computer, Motorola Satellite phone, EPRIRB, Instruments and alarm system, Wood Freeman autopilot with remote steering from upper station, Mathers electronic dual controls, two 500 watt headlights and one movable spotlight, 8 deck LED flood lights.
HULL; Forward crash compartment. Second compartment, crew cabin and water tank under sole. Third compartment, engine room with forward bulkhead and wing fuel tanks. Fourth compartment, guest cabins with wing fuel tanks. Fifth compartment, rudders and steering with bulkhead and wing water tanks. Total of five fuel tanks and six water tanks.
